~ OTTO KUHLER ~

American (b. Germany) (1894-1977).

Kuhler's fascination with the steel industry began as a young boy in Germany, where he made drawings in the bustling and prosperous Kuhler Forges, founded by his great-grandfather. After he moved from Europe to Pittsburgh in 1923, he enjoyed considerable com-mercial success as an etcher of locomotives and industrial sub-jects. This watercolor was probably commissioned by a Pittsburgh steel company.


Steel Mills, 1938.

Watercolor on heavy laid paper, watermarked 1936. Signed in watercolor. Dated Nov., 29, 1938 verso.
10 3/4 x 8 3/8"; 273 x 213mm.

An accomplished watercolor painted in vibrant shades of predomi-nantly blue, purple and red.
